Description

This complaint is for a "Slip and fall" is a term used for a personal injury case in which a person slips or trips and is injured on someone else's property. These cases usually fall under the broader category of cases known as "premises liability" claims.

In Connecticut, the statute of limitations for filing a Connecticut Complaint (Slip and Fall) is typically two years from the date of your injury. This time limit is essential, as missing it can result in losing your right to seek compensation. Therefore, it is crucial to take action promptly after your slip and fall incident. The slip and fall law in Connecticut primarily focuses on the responsibility of property owners to maintain safe premises. When a property owner fails to address hazards or warn visitors, they may be held liable for injuries sustained from slip and fall accidents.
